About Kalihi Valley District Park

Dive Into Recreation

At the heart of this 9-acre community space sits a 50-meter swimming pool that's basically paradise for lap swimmers. And don't worry if you're still working on your technique or have little ones in tow - there's also a training pool and a charming wading pool where the younger crowd can splash around safely.

Not much of a swimmer? No problem. There's also a well-maintained gymnasium for those rainy Hawaiian days, plus outdoor courts for basketball, tennis, and volleyball when the sun's shining (which, let's be honest, is most of the time in Honolulu). Baseball fans can catch some action or join a game at the baseball field that anchors one end of the park.

Community Hub

The City and County of Honolulu's Department of Parks and Recreation keeps things running smoothly here, maintaining the grounds and organizing activities that bring the neighborhood together.

During the year, you can find everything from summer programs where kids can burn off energy to adult fitness classes where you might actually make good on those exercise resolutions. The park offers both recreational facilities and community activities throughout the year.
